The Oklahoma City Thunder became the first team to advance to the second round of the 2026 NBA playoffs after completing a sweep of the Phoenix Suns with a 131-122 win on Monday, April 27, 2026.

Shai Gilgeous-Alexander led the Thunder with 35 points, while Jalen Williams added 28 points and 7 assists. The Thunder dominated the series with a balanced attack and strong defense.

The Suns, led by Devin Booker's 30 points and Kevin Durant's 25, fought hard but could not overcome the Thunder's depth and home-court advantage. The series ended with a decisive Game 4 victory for Oklahoma City.

The Thunder will face the winner of the series between the Denver Nuggets and the Los Angeles Lakers in the Western Conference semifinals.
